Rocky Mountain Orthodontics outlines expansion plans; EDC finds company in compliance
Summary
Representatives for Rocky Mountain Orthodontics reported roughly $2.7 million in personal property and nearly $500,000 in real property investments and forecast 100 employees by year‑end; the commission approved separate compliance findings for the facility's real and personal property incentives.
Rocky Mountain Orthodontics told the Franklin City Economic Development Commission that its project at 2165 Earlywood Drive has produced about $2.7 million in personal property investment and nearly $500,000 in real property investment, and the commission found the company in compliance on both the real and personal property items.
